Outstanding Picture Brightness — Advanced 3LCD technology displays 100% of the RGB color signal for every frame. This allows for outstanding color accuracy while maintaining excellent color brightness, without any distracting “rainbowing” or “color brightness” issues seen with other projection technologies

This projector is a tale of the good and the bad. I researched dozens of projectors before landing on this unit based on the several factors including price, brightness, availability, mounting options and options for IP control. Upon receiving the unit, I mounted the projector to my ceiling with a universal mount (not included with this purchase) and turned it on. The first thing I noticed was that the picture was upside down and the quick start guide that is included does not specify how to correct this. A quick google search identified 2 ways to correct this, either by using the remote to control the upside down picture and navigating the menus or through the web interface, which you can only access after finding the IP address of the projector.After correcting the upside down picture, I was startled by the sheer brightness of the picture. At 3200 lumens, the picture is as bright as any tv I have ever owned and powers through ambient light. My delight soon dimmed as I realized the noise I thought was a plane flying over my house was actually this projector. I read the other reviews for this product before my purchase and did not a few other reviewers making reference to the noise. I can assure you, the noise is quite noticeable and I am hoping it gets quieter as it burns in as a few others have notated.A concern I had prior to the purchase, was the 1080 vs 4k discussion and I am happy to report that I don’t think the price upgrade to 4k matters with the projector. The image is bright, crisp and clear and is visually stunning. I get so many comments on the clarity of the picture and no one can believe it is actually a projector. Just for those folks looking at the 1080 vs 4k, streaming devices are only streaming at 1080. I have watched 4k movies with this projector and did not miss the fact that the projector was not 4k in the slightest.The reason I am rating this unit at 4 starts is two fold, one being the noise of the unit and the second is the ability to integrate this particular unit into other systems, namely Home Assistant. Other Epson projectors have the ability to use PJ Link or other integrations and to date, I have not found a way to that with this unit. The Home Cinema 1080 does not have RS232 ports and does not seem to work with the ESC/vp.net commands either. I will update this review in the future if I can find a way to make this work.Overall, the picture is well worth the cost of this unit. If you will be bothered by the noise or the lack of integrations available, you will need to jump into a more expensive unit.
